Key concepts and overview
At the heart of the online casino experience are the game providers, companies that develop and supply games to online casinos. These providers create a range of gaming options, including slots, table games, and live dealer experiences. The role of game providers extends beyond mere game development; they are also responsible for ensuring that their games meet regulatory standards and provide a fair gaming experience. This section will outline the core concepts related to game providers, including their business models, the types of games they produce, and their relationships with online casinos.
- Business Models: Game providers typically operate on a B2B (business-to-business) model, supplying games to online casinos that then offer these games to players.
- Types of Games: The games produced can vary widely, from traditional slots to innovative video slots and live dealer games.
- Regulatory Compliance: Game providers must adhere to strict regulations to ensure fairness and security in their games.
Main features and details
The process of how game providers shape online casino libraries involves several important components. First, game providers invest in research and development to create engaging and innovative games that attract players. This includes the use of advanced technology, such as HTML5, which allows games to be played on various devices, including smartphones and tablets. Additionally, game providers often collaborate with online casinos to tailor their offerings based on player preferences and market trends.
- Game Development: The development process includes concept creation, design, programming, and testing to ensure a high-quality gaming experience.
- Market Research: Providers conduct market research to understand player preferences and trends, which informs their game development strategies.
- Collaboration with Casinos: Game providers work closely with online casinos to integrate their games into the casino’s platform, ensuring a seamless user experience.
